What are the ticket types, and what is the difference?

1. GENERAL ADMISSION
Type of ticket that allows entry to the event at any time but does not guarantee a specific or reserved area. For Friday 26 and Saturday 27 July parking close to Masseria Capece is included.

2.⁠ ⁠ALL AREA ACCESS IN BACKSTAGE
Type of ticket that allows entry to the event at any time and guarantees access to all the backstage areas (with reserved bar stations and toilets). The ticket includes parking on site in front of Masseria Capece with private entrance.

3. EARLY ENTRY
General admission ticket that allows entry to the event ONLY before 9:30 PM and not later.
The ticket does not guarantee a specific or reserved area. Lower price.

For Friday 26 and Saturday 27 July parking close to Masseria Capece is included.

Each ticket holder will be given an electronic wristband at the entrance.
Leaving the festival and returning will not be possible.

IMPORTANT! Each ticket holder will be given an electronic wristband at the entrance.
Pass holders will be able to leave the festival and returning during different days only with a valid electronic wristband. 

Entering and leaving events on the same day will not be possible for security reasons: once the QR code is scanned at the entrance, the ticket will be automatically invalidated.

ON-SITE FACILITIES

How can I pay inside the festival?

Polifonic is a cashless festival.

Each ticket holder will receive an electronic wristband at the entrance. You can load money at authorised cash desks or by downloading the Slesh app, available on Apple and Android stores.

GENERAL POLICY

What is the minimum age at the festival?

The event is accessible only to adults (18+).

What is not permitted inside the festival?

For security reasons entrance to Polifonic venues is not permitted with suitcases or large bags, large backpacks, skateboards, professional camera equipment without permission, food or drink coming from outside. Other prohibited items are aerosols, drones, laser pointers, selfie sticks, big umbrellas, sharp objects, motorcycle helmets, spray cans, beach umbrellas and other bulky beach items.

Smaller bags, backpacks, small umbrellas and empty water bottles will be permitted.

Any hostile and disrespectful behaviour towards any person during the festival will not be tolerated.

What's the policy on (soft-)drugs?

There is an absolute zero-tolerance policy concerning the possession, sale, purchase, or use of hard and soft drugs at the festival site.

Will there be a first aid post at the festival?

During festival hours, we will have a mobile medical team available at the venue. There will also be emergency response teams in the direct vicinity of the festival and a stationary first aid post (easily recognizable near the entrance) at the festival.
We work closely with local authorities and emergency services to ensure a safe and healthy festival experience.
